Gov. Obaseki demolishes Tony Kabaka’s residence in Benin

0

There is currently palpable tension in Benin City as the Edo State Government has finally carried out it’s threat in demolishing the residence of oppositional figures in the state.

Recall late last year the state government earmarked some hotels belonging to known oppositional members in the state for demolition because of their opposition to Obaseki.

The hotel of Tony Kabala which had court documents restraining the state government from the demolition was suddenly destroyed this morning.

Obaseki rolled in bulldozers and as we speak the building is been brought down.

Already residents of Ugbor area where the Hotel is located in Benin have taken to the streets in protest.
